PineappleCoconut · 04/12/2025 17:08

I love mine
I do still have to mop every so often as it’s not great on muddy footprints from the garden.
And you have to empty the dirty water tank frequently or it starts to stink.

Think I paid just over £300 earlier in the year.

Bookpage · 04/12/2025 17:12

I don't have that one but I have one that mops.

I love love love it as a sweeper, but unless I'm doing something wrong I don't love the mopping. It seems to make everything very wet, even on the lowest setting, and just smears dirty water about, even if I wash the "mop" after every use.

@Bookpage , the C20 goes back to its stand and washes the mops itself, dries them, then sets off again. Takes ages (or maybe my floors especially mucky). I had a lots of fun watching it the first time 😀

GiantTeddyIsTired · 05/12/2025 13:27

I do like it - but, I've had to remove some rugs (that were on a heated floor, so I couldn't really tape down), and it still catches its mops on other rugs.

It's not very good at the edges, I have to run the hoover round those myself - but TBH, I'll take it as an upgrade on my old eufy (just hoover, about 10 years old, bumbled around rather than planned and executed) because the water it's mopping up, despite going round every day, is filthy, so I can only imagine how dirty my floors used to be when I basically just mopped once a year!

It's also easier to find if it's gone out and about and got wedged under the settee.

I like it so much that once I've got the upstairs under control, I'm considering getting a second one for upstairs (currently horrible old carpet, planning to replace with nice thick laminat)
